Had a post about what a great vacation yesterday, I didn't start that way. Evening before we left had torrential rain and yard was flooded around parking spot for camper, didn't want to pull it out through the new lake so I hooked up and tried to jack knife it around the building. It didn't work out with a tree being in the way but got it eventually. Didn't know that while backing to tight I had guillotined the 7 wire cable to the camper. The ok part was nothing damaged on truck except the charge fuse blew but what I didn't know was a few strands of the 7 wire on the trailer were still hot and shorting out. Melted the harness back to junction box under camper. As soon as I got out of the truck I disconnected the battery at the box and the cable was smoking. NO FUSE at the battery. Had never gave it a thought. Check your trailers, you may have a full time hot all the way from your battery to who knows where. I'm installing one of those large bolt on fuses at the battery. What kind of amp rating should I be looking for?
